The healing time for a beard transplant can vary depending on the individual and the extent of the procedure, but here's a general overview:
The initial recovery period after a beard transplant typically lasts around 10-14 days. During this time, it's essential to follow the instructions provided by your surgeon to ensure proper healing and minimize any complications. The transplanted hair grafts will go through a shedding phase, known as "shock loss," where the initial transplanted hairs may fall out. This is a normal part of the process, as the new hair follicles take root and begin to grow.
After the initial two-week period, the healing process continues, and you can expect to see gradual improvements in the appearance of your beard. The transplanted hair follicles will begin to produce new hair growth, which can take several months to fully develop. On average, most patients will see 60-80% of the transplanted hair growth within the first 6-12 months after the procedure.
It's important to note that the healing time can vary depending on factors such as the extent of the transplant, the individual's healing ability, and any underlying medical conditions. Some patients may experience a faster recovery, while others may take a bit longer. It's crucial to follow the post-operative instructions provided by your surgeon and attend all scheduled follow-up appointments to ensure optimal results.
One of the most significant benefits of a beard transplant in New York is the natural-looking results that can be achieved. The transplanted hair follicles will grow and behave like the rest of your beard hair, providing a seamless and undetectable appearance. However, it's essential to have realistic expectations and understand that the final results may not be visible until 12-18 months after the procedure.
Throughout the healing process, it's common to experience some temporary side effects, such as swelling, redness, and mild discomfort. These are typically managed with pain medication and following the recommended aftercare instructions. It's also important to avoid strenuous activities and direct sunlight exposure during the initial recovery period to protect the transplanted hair grafts.
